Quarterly Planning Note — Helvane Instruments

For the board: the gross-margin review shows erosion of 2.1 points, driven chiefly by input costs on the Sorrel sensor line and discounting in the Westbrooke territory. We propose tightened discount authority, a component resourcing study, and quarterly margin checkpoints. Detailed workings are attached; the confidential direction is set out immediately below.

board note of fahog-bawep: The renewal with Holixax Holdings closes at $20 million a year, 20 percent below the last contract. Project Druwyn slips by two quarters because of the supplier delay.

Finance summary, department heads only. Subject: closure of the Marbury Lane office. Lease terminates end of Q2; exit costs land within the reserve set last review. Eleven staff relocate to the Calden site; two roles end. Facilities handles asset disposal, payroll handles transfers. Net annual saving is material and flows into next year's base. One confidential item on forward plans sits below.

board note of fahif-yahog: Gross margin on Wenath came in at 10 percent against a plan of 5 percent. Only 3 of the 100 pilot accounts renewed Wenath, so a churn review is set for July 15.

Minutes — Management Meeting, Pellwright Holdings. Attendees reviewed the renewal of the fleet policy with Ardenvale Assurance. The 7% premium increase was accepted after careful comparison with two alternative quotes. Ms. Farrow will finalise documentation by month-end, and claims history will be audited before next renewal. Department heads noted no objections. The confidential note below concerns forward planning.

board note of tawig-bajof: The renewal with Ralixix Holdings closes at $10 million a year, 20 percent above the last contract. Project Druix slips by two quarters because of the tooling delay.

## Flaky Integration Tests — Ledgerline Payments

The Ledgerline integration suite talks to a sandboxed acquirer emulator, and roughly 5% of runs fail on timing-sensitive settlement checks. Before filing a bug, retry the suite once; genuine failures reproduce consistently. If the emulator gets wedged, reset it via the maintenance shell on the staging box. The shell prompts for the emulator recovery passphrase before wiping state. Contractors are cleared to use it, so it's recorded below for convenience:

strongbox words: ulaael-wenix